Storm Damage Restoration in the Town of Oyster Bay, NY

Oyster Bay’s dual-shore storm damage profile produces two distinct restoration patterns. The south shore — Massapequa, Seaford, Wantagh — faces Great South Bay storm surge and barrier island exposure during Atlantic storms, with Category 3 flooding events requiring the full south shore storm/water combined protocol. The north shore — Oyster Bay village, Cold Spring Harbor, Bayville — faces Sound shore tidal surge amplified by the geometry of Oyster Bay Harbor, which funnels surge into the village waterfront. The interior communities face the standard Nassau wind damage and ice dam pattern from every significant nor’easter. Insurance Context for Storm Damage in Oyster Bay

Wind damage, ice dam damage, and roof damage from storm events are covered perils under standard homeowners policies. Storm surge and overland flooding require flood insurance. The coverage boundary — distinguishing wind-driven rain damage (potentially homeowners) from surge flooding (flood insurance) — is the most frequently disputed line in Long Island storm claims. Cost Benchmarks

  • Emergency tarping (typical residential roof damage): $800–$3,500.
  • Nor’easter roof restoration (shingle replacement + decking): $8,000–$28,000.
  • Tree impact through roof (moderate structural scope): $18,000–$55,000.
  • Storm surge flooding (coastal communities where applicable): $15,000–$45,000+.
